Answer: 0.6066 as a fraction is 3033/5000
Converting the decimal number 0.6066 into a fraction might seem tricky at first, but with the right steps, it's straightforward. This guide will walk you through the entire process, ensuring you understand each part of the conversion.
The decimal 0.6066 can be broken down as:
0.6066 = 0 + 0.6066
Here, 0 is the whole number part, and 0.6066 is the decimal part.
Focus on converting the decimal part, 0.6066, to a fraction. To do this, consider the place value of the decimal:
0.6066 =
6066
10000
Now, simplify the fraction 6066/10000. To do this, find the greatest common divisor (GCD) of 6066 and 10000.
Now, divide both the numerator and the denominator by their GCD:
6066 ÷ 2
10000 ÷ 2
=
3033
5000
So, 0.6066 as a fraction is 3033/5000
